about

"This is a 'remix of a remake' of a song I wrote and recorded back in 1996 entitled "Rythmic Rhyme." I had re-recorded it over the instrumental version of Brother Ali's Good Lord to perform it at a show only to find out that my friend and fellow artist, B.A. had used the same instrumental to record a version of his song "Hip-Hop Head," with then label mate Ice Haze and Young Royalty Records recording artist J. Gotti. A version of it was tracked in Gotti's studio and released on BOOC Entertainment's "Cook Kane Kitchen vol. 2." Subsequently, Ice had left BOOC Ent. and retired from making music and was not around to perform the song during live shows anymore and I was asked to fill in w/ a shortened version of one of my verses from "Rhythmic Rhyme." As this was a common reoccurrence, I was also asked by BA to fill in for Ice, but this time in the studio when the song was to be re-recorded for BA's mixtape "I Am Who I Am." Though I was reluctant to do so, being that Ice was a good friend of mine and I was fond of his original verse on that song and the fact that this would be the 4th time I had recorded this song I wrote way back in high school, I did accept and the album was released w/ my verse in place of Ice's. Now, as I'm putting out a compilation of collaborative materials from the past year or so, I thought it'd be a great opportunity to release the song as one big mash up of both "Hip-Hop Head" and "Rhythmic Rhyme." I took the 3 different mixes w/ 3 different eq settings, 3 different compression ratios and 2 different tempos to my friend, label mate and boss "T" from The Noose. He took the necessary parts from each mix and matched tempos and pitch, trying to even out the eq's and compression settings as best anyone can do in that situation and cut it all together." -Atafal Wonder
